In a distributed system, the synchronization of tasks executed in different nodes is necessary. Therefore, we propose a method of synchronization of tasks in a distributed system using FlexRay. FlexRay is expected to become a dominant protocol in automotive systems. It supports a clock synchronization mechanism. We present two methods for synchronization of tasks using a clock synchronized by FlexRay. One is a synchronization method for the start point of tasks. The other is a synchronization method for specific points in the task. We implement the proposed method as an experiment.
